首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Erlang Ranch Websocket客户端无法检测到断开的Internet连接

Erlang Ranch是一个开源的Erlang/OTP应用框架,用于构建高性能、可扩展和并发的网络应用程序。它提供了一套简单且易于使用的工具,用于开发基于WebSocket协议的客户端和服务器。

WebSocket是一种网络通信协议,它使得客户端和服务器之间可以进行双向通信,而无需客户端发起请求。它建立在HTTP协议之上,通过一个长连接实现实时通信。WebSocket可以在各种应用程序中使用,例如在线聊天、实时协作和实时数据更新等。

对于Erlang Ranch WebSocket客户端无法检测到断开的Internet连接的问题,可能有以下几个原因和解决方法:

  1. 客户端代码问题:检查你的Erlang Ranch WebSocket客户端代码,确保正确处理了断开连接的情况。例如,可以在接收到关闭连接事件时进行相应的处理,例如重新连接或提示用户连接已断开。
  2. 网络问题:断开的Internet连接可能是由网络故障或连接中断导致的。你可以检查网络连接状态,并确保网络稳定。如果发现连接不稳定,可以尝试重新连接或采取其他网络恢复措施。
  3. 服务器问题:检查你的WebSocket服务器,确保它能够正确处理连接断开的情况。可能需要进行服务器端的配置或代码调整,以确保在连接断开时能够发送适当的关闭消息或执行相应的处理。

值得注意的是,虽然我不能提及特定的云计算品牌商,但你可以参考腾讯云提供的WebSocket相关产品和服务,例如腾讯云 WebSocket API网关,它提供了一种简单且可靠的方式来管理和扩展WebSocket应用程序。你可以查阅腾讯云的相关文档和介绍,以了解更多有关腾讯云WebSocket相关产品的信息。

腾讯云 WebSocket API网关产品介绍链接:https://cloud.tencent.com/product/wag

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券